Output 8598cda4bae891e0ba15d9d99a6dbd9f2e9e2cbd15d5fb968789925dce695418:3

value
275881868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7d554d4930d8601662c9abc1b35984e39f9f2d7 OP_EQUALVERIFY OP_CHECKSIG
address
1N8peqVtswMe7kVNwFA23pnvpSEnkTshqN
transaction
8598cda4bae891e0ba15d9d99a6dbd9f2e9e2cbd15d5fb968789925dce695418
spent
true